Hi,

During a rebuild of all packages in sid, your package failed to build on
amd64.

From mono-devel's changelog:
+ Dropped /usr/bin/csc as it was causing a file conflict with the chicken
  compiler from the chicken-bin package. Most source packages were
  transitioned to use /usr/bin/mono-csc or /usr/bin/cli-csc instead.
  (Closes: #509367, #518106)
